Synopsis

Kate Jasper, Marin County, California's own, organically grown, amateur sleuth returns in this eleventh mystery in the series. ("Kate Jasper is a keeper!"--MERITORIOUS MYSTERIES.) In MURDER, MY DEER, Kate and her sweetie's budding romance has finally flowered into a full-fledged marriage. But no one ever promised them a rose garden. Deer have gate-crashed their yard to munch every bud, blossom, and petal. Instead of happily honeymooning, Kate and her sweetie attend the Deer-Abused support group for those whose dearly-beloved plants have been deerly-beheaded. Antlers clash during group discussion since everyone has their own idea for deer prevention...from feeding them to killing them. Doctor Searle Sandstrom, ex-military, would like to use a gun, napalm, and land mines. But someone bashes in his head first, and no one spots any hoofprints near his dead body. Killing season is open, and Kate is game to flush out the hunter before she becomes the hunted game.

About the Author

Jaqueline Girdner is the author of eleven Kate Jasper mysteries, including Death Hits the Fan, A Cry for Self-Help, Most Likely to Die, and A Stiff Critique. She has been a psychiatric aide, a family law attorney, and an incorrigible entrepreneur during her forty-nine years in California. Jaqueline lives, works, practices tai chi, and involuntarily feeds deer her roses in Marin County, California, along with her favorite computer peripheral, husband Gregory Booi.

From Publishers Weekly

Kate Jasper and her crew of Marin County's most lovable loonies are back (after 1999's Murder on the Astral Plane), which is good news for the many fans of this sort of shrewd, zany mystery romp. Kate, who runs a business called Jest Gifts when she's not solving crimes, has just married her live-in lover, restaurant and art gallery owner Wayne Caruso, at the Marin county clerk's office, but she hasn't yet told anyone--especially not her obnoxious family. Imagine Kate's chagrin when Felix Byrne, an equally unpleasant reporter friend, shows up at a meeting of the Deerly Abused, a group of local residents keen to control the deer that munch their gardens. Felix has learned about the secret wedding, but he stumbles (literally) into a bigger story when one member of this group--who advocates blasting the doe-eyed predators with Claymore mines--is discovered dead from a crushed skull. Suspects abound: a former actress who wraps herself in layers of clothes to ward off attention; a plastic surgeon with a roving eye; an heiress with a support-group fetish; an eccentric black British postmistress; a slick Asian chef and television star--the whole Agatha Christie crew, as it were, transplanted to Girdner's fictional town of Abierto. When the local police chief turns out to be an addled elder who sings "I Feel Pretty" during interrogations, it's up to Kate to dig out everybody's hidden connections to the dead man. If this is your kind of thing, Girdner does it as deftly as anyone. (Mar.)
